Coglin Surname Meaning
From Where Does The Surname Originate? meaning and history
This surname is derived from the name of an ancestor. 'the son of Cockelin,' from Cock (which see), used personally; diminutive Cockelin. The customary laziness brought this down to Coglin.
Agnes Cokelin, Cambridgeshire, 1273. Hundred Rolls.
Imania Cokelin, Cambridgeshire, ibid.

How Common Is The Last Name Coglin? popularity and diffusion
The last name is the 1,281,391st most frequently held surname in the world, held by around 1 in 40,941,269 people. The surname Coglin is primarily found in Africa, where 45 percent of Coglin reside; 45 percent reside in Southern Africa and 45 percent reside in South Bantu Africa.
This surname is most numerous in South Africa, where it is held by 80 people, or 1 in 677,221. In South Africa it is most numerous in: Gauteng, where 85 percent reside and Mpumalanga, where 15 percent reside. Outside of South Africa this last name exists in 9 countries. It is also common in The United States, where 34 percent reside and England, where 12 percent reside.
Coglin Family Population Trend historical fluctuation
The occurrence of Coglin has changed over time. In The United States the share of the population with the surname fell 14 percent between 1880 and 2014 and in England it fell 42 percent between 1881 and 2014.
